Official title

Long-Term Follow-Up of Subjects Treated With NTLA 2002

Overview

This is a follow-up study of subjects who received NTLA-2002 in a previous clinical trial as an observational evaluation of the long-term effects of the investigational therapy.

Primary outcome measures

  • Incidence of treatment-related Adverse Events (AEs); incidence of treatment-related Serious Adverse Events (SAEs); incidence of treatment-related Adverse Events of Special Interest (AESIs) defined per protocol [Time frame: up to 15 years]
Secondary outcome measures (6)
  • To evaluate the long-term efficacy of NTLA-2002 in previously treated subjects [Time frame: up to 15 years]
  • Change from baseline in consumption of on-demand HAE medications for reported HAE attacks [Time frame: up to 15 years]
  • Change from baseline in healthcare utilization for HAE attacks [Time frame: up to 15 years]
  • Change from baseline in QoL parameters as measured by the MOXIE Angioedema-QoL instrument. [Time frame: up to 5 years]
  • Change from baseline in QoL parameters as measured by the EQ-5D-5L instrument. [Time frame: up to 5 years]
  • Change from baseline in QoL parameters as measured by the WPAI:GH instrument. [Time frame: up to 5 years]

Eligibility criteria

Inclusion criteria

  • A subject has completed or discontinued from an Intellia-sponsored or -supported treatment protocol in which a complete or partial dose of NTLA-2002 was received.
  • A subject has provided informed consent for the LTFU study.
  • A subject is willing to attend study visits, complete protocol-required follow-up schedule, and comply with the study requirements.

Exclusion criteria

None
